UNPKG

mathjslab

Version:

MathJSLab - An interpreter with language syntax like MATLAB®/Octave. ISBN 978-65-00-82338-7

20 lines (17 loc) 759 B
import { LinearAlgebra } from './linear-algebra'; describe('LinearAlgebra', () => { it('LinearAlgebra should be defined', () => { expect(LinearAlgebra).toBeDefined(); }); it('LinearAlgebra.functions and its methods should be defined', () => { expect(LinearAlgebra.functions).toBeDefined(); expect(LinearAlgebra.trace).toBeDefined(); expect(LinearAlgebra.transpose).toBeDefined(); expect(LinearAlgebra.ctranspose).toBeDefined(); expect(LinearAlgebra.mul).toBeDefined(); expect(LinearAlgebra.det).toBeDefined(); expect(LinearAlgebra.inv).toBeDefined(); expect(LinearAlgebra.gauss).toBeDefined(); expect(LinearAlgebra.lu).toBeDefined(); }); });